如何在Linux中快速定位到文件的首行?

在Linux中,可以使用sed命令将文本文件的第一行替换为指定的字符串。要将文件file.txt的第一行替换为_Linux,可以使用以下命令:,,``bash,sed i '1c _Linux' file.txt,``

在Linux系统中,经常需要在命令行或文本编辑器中快速跳转到行的开头,小编将详细介绍如何在Linux系统中实现光标快速跳转到行首的方法,并探讨其背后的技术原理及应用场景:

linux 到首行_Linux
(图片来源网络,侵删)

1、使用快捷键跳转到行首

Ctrl+A:这是在Linux命令行中最常用的方法之一,通过按下Ctrl+A组合键,光标会立即移至当前行的开头,这一功能利用了GNU Readline库,它为许多Linux命令行程序提供了行编辑和历史功能。

Home键:使用键盘上的Home键也可以将光标移至行首,其作用类似于Ctrl+A,但更加直观和简单,在大多数Linux发行版中,Home键的功能都是默认启用的。

2、在文本编辑器Vim中跳转到行首

gg命令:在Vim编辑器中,使用gg命令可以将光标直接跳转到文档的第一行,这是一种非常快速的方式,特别适用于处理大型文件时需要快速回到文件顶部的场景。

linux 到首行_Linux
(图片来源网络,侵删)

数字加G命令:输入1G也会将光标移动到文件的第一行,这里的数字可以是任意行号,提供了一个更通用的跳转到指定行首的方法。

3、使用Alt键结合快捷键

Alt+Home:在某些Linux终端模拟器中,可以使用Alt+Home组合键来将光标移至行首,这种方式较少见,但在一些特定的环境下仍然适用。

4、为何需要快速跳转到行首

提高编辑效率:无论是编写代码、编辑配置文件还是撰写文档,快速跳转到行首可以显著提高工作效率,特别是在需要频繁修改文件起始部分的场景下。

linux 到首行_Linux
(图片来源网络,侵删)

方便命令行操作:在命令行环境中,用户可能需要频繁地修改或重用之前的命令,能够快速跳转到行首使得修改命令变得更加快捷和方便。

5、场景应用

编程与开发:开发人员在编码或调试时经常需要快速定位到代码的开始位置,使用上述快捷键可以大幅提高开发效率。

系统管理:系统管理员在编辑配置文件或快速调整命令时,能通过行首跳转快捷键节省大量时间。

在Linux系统中,无论是在命令行还是文本编辑器里,都有多种方法可以实现光标快速跳转到行首,掌握这些方法不仅可以提高日常工作的效率,还能使在Linux环境下的操作更加熟练和流畅。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/581871.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-08-10 15:00
Next 2024-08-10 15:11

相关推荐

  • 如何快速掌握Linux操作系统的常用命令?

    Linux操作系统命令是用户与系统交互的重要工具。常用的命令包括文件操作(如ls, cd, cp, rm),系统管理(如ps, top, shutdown),文本处理(如grep, sed, awk),网络工具(如ping, ifconfig, netstat),权限管理(如chmod, chown, su)等。这些命令能帮助用户高效地完成日常任务和系统管理。

    2024-07-28
    057
  • 如何配置并切换Linux系统中的用户?

    在Linux中,可以使用su命令切换用户。输入su加上要切换到的用户名,然后按回车键。系统会提示输入该用户的密码,输入正确的密码后即可切换成功。

    2024-07-25
    054
  • 虚拟主机如何设置定时任务

    使用crontab命令设置定时任务,编辑定时任务脚本并保存,然后通过crontab -e命令将脚本添加到定时任务列表中。

    2024-05-11
    0119
  • 如何使用Linux命令检查数据库状态?

    在Linux中,查看数据库状态的命令取决于您使用的数据库系统。对于MySQL,您可以使用mysqladmin status命令;对于PostgreSQL,可以使用pg_stat_activity查询;而对于MongoDB,则可以使用db.serverStatus()命令。请根据您使用的数据库类型选择合适的命令。

    2024-08-04
    077
  • 如何在Linux中统计代码行数并获取代码提交的行数?

    要在Linux中统计代码行数,可以使用wc命令。要获取名为example.txt的文本文件中的代码行数,可以运行以下命令:,,``bash,wc l example.txt,``,,这将输出文件中的行数。

    2024-08-05
    066
  • 如何清理服务器上的视频缓存?

    服务器视频缓存清理方法服务器视频缓存的清理是确保服务器性能和稳定性的重要步骤,本文将详细介绍如何清理服务器视频缓存,包括Linux系统命令、Web服务器缓存、数据库缓存以及应用程序缓存的清理方法,以下是具体内容:一、Linux系统缓存清理1. 使用sync命令同步磁盘缓冲区在清理缓存之前,建议先执行sync命令……

    2024-12-06
    04

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入